Do's & Don'ts
Read this before you apply. These are non-negotiable — they keep the program serious and the cohort high quality.
Do's
- Arrive by 8:00 AM sharp — punctuality is non-negotiable
- Bring your laptop, charger, and notebook every day
- Push code to GitHub at the end of every day
- Ask questions early — there are no stupid questions, only stuck students
- Help your fellow interns. Teaching cements your own learning
- Treat client work as confidential — never share code outside the program
- Notify your mentor and the program lead in advance if you must miss a day
- Dress smart casual — you'll be on calls with real clients
- Take notes daily and keep a learning journal
- Use Slack/Discord for all program communication, not WhatsApp DMs
- Show up for mentorship sessions prepared with specific questions
- Embrace code reviews — feedback is a gift, not an attack
Don'ts
- Don't be late — repeated lateness leads to dismissal from the program
- Don't copy-paste solutions from ChatGPT without understanding them
- Don't share client codebases, credentials, or designs publicly
- Don't use the office Wi-Fi for streaming, torrents, or personal downloads
- Don't bring alcohol, cigarettes, or any drugs to the workspace
- Don't ghost — communicate openly if you're struggling or want to leave
- Don't argue with mentors during code review. Listen first, discuss later
- Don't promise clients work or timelines on your own — escalate first
- Don't browse social media during lecture and lab hours
- Don't skip the daily commit — even a small PR keeps the rhythm
- Don't disrespect your fellow interns based on background or skill level
- Don't expect to be hired automatically — earn it through visible work
Transparent Pricing
Pay monthly at UGX 300,000/month, or save by committing to a longer track upfront.
Starter Track
1 Month
Perfect for university attachments needing a short, intensive placement.
- Full 8 AM – 5 PM daily access
- Core curriculum (HTML, CSS, JS, intro to React)
- 1 real production task to contribute to
- Attachment certificate
- Access to Discord community
Standard Track
3 Months
The most popular option — enough time to actually become hire-ready.
- Everything in Starter
- Full curriculum: React, Next.js, Databases, Deployment
- 3–5 production projects on your GitHub
- Dedicated 1:1 mentor + weekly reviews
- Portfolio + CV review sessions
- Internship completion certificate
- Save UGX 100,000 vs paying month-by-month
Career Track
6 Months
Full transformation — go from beginner to junior-developer-ready.
- Everything in Standard
- Advanced topics: AWS, Docker, CI/CD, Testing
- Lead a small feature on a live client project
- Career prep: interviews, salary negotiation, LinkedIn
- Referrals to Desishub's hiring partners
- Senior engineer letter of recommendation
- Save UGX 300,000 vs paying month-by-month
Payment methods: MTN Mobile Money, Airtel Money, bank transfer, or cash at the office. Monthly installments available — talk to us.
